With another cryptic teaser, Nothing keeps us guessing about their upcoming launch of Nothing Phone (3) on July 1. Last month’s sneak peek on X offered a slightly broader view of the device, but left plenty to the imagination. In its first true flagship, Nothing aims to make a big splash with “ultra-precise engineering” and a possible design overhaul.

Nothing’s new teaser zooms out a bit from the initial image, but doesn’t reveal the Phone (3)’s whole look. It’s exciting that Nothing might dispense with its transparent back, a staple of previous models. Glyph LED lights may be replaced with a customizable dot-matrix display, signalling a bold pivot in the brand’s aesthetic. The teasers reaffirm the speculation, aligning with CEO Carl Pei’s claim that the Phone (3) is the company’s highest-end device.

According to reports, the phone will have a 6.77-inch LTPO AMOLED screen, three cameras with a 50MP main sensor, and a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Elite processor for top-tier performance. It will feature Android 16 and Nothing OS 3.0 and promise an enhanced user experience.
